DBeaver中执行SQL文件的方法

作者:谁偷走了我的奶酪2024.04.01 15:20浏览量:68

简介:本文将介绍如何在DBeaver这一流行的数据库管理工具中执行SQL文件,包括导入SQL文件和执行其中的命令。通过本文,您将了解DBeaver的实际应用和操作经验,从而更加高效地使用它进行数据库操作。

DBeaver 是一款开源的数据库管理工具,支持多种数据库类型,如 MySQL、PostgreSQL、SQLite、Oracle 等。它为用户提供了一个直观的图形界面,方便用户执行 SQL 查询、管理数据库结构以及进行其他数据库相关操作。在 DBeaver 中执行 SQL 文件是一个常见的需求,下面将介绍如何进行操作。

1. 打开 DBeaver 并连接到数据库

首先,启动 DBeaver 并连接到您想要执行 SQL 文件的数据库。在 DBeaver 的主界面,点击左上角的“数据库导航”按钮,选择您的数据库类型,然后填写连接信息,如主机名、端口、用户名和密码等,以建立连接。

2. 导入 SQL 文件

在成功连接到数据库后,您可以通过以下步骤导入 SQL 文件:

  1. 在数据库导航树中,找到您要执行 SQL 文件的数据库,右键点击它。
  2. 在弹出的菜单中,选择“SQL 编辑器”或“执行 SQL 脚本”选项。
  3. 在打开的 SQL 编辑器中,点击工具栏上的“打开文件”按钮(通常是一个文件夹图标)。
  4. 在文件选择对话框中,找到并选中您的 SQL 文件,然后点击“打开”按钮。

此时,SQL 文件的内容将显示在 SQL 编辑器中。

3. 执行 SQL 文件

导入 SQL 文件后,您可以按照以下步骤执行其中的命令:

  1. 确保 SQL 编辑器中的内容是您想要执行的 SQL 文件。
  2. 点击工具栏上的“执行”按钮(通常是一个绿色的播放按钮图标),或者使用快捷键(通常是 Ctrl+Enter 或 F9)。
  3. DBeaver 将逐条执行 SQL 文件中的命令,并在下方的“结果”面板中显示执行结果。

请注意,执行 SQL 文件可能需要一些时间,具体取决于文件中的命令数量和数据库的性能。

4. 查看执行结果

执行完 SQL 文件后,您可以在“结果”面板中查看执行结果。DBeaver 会根据不同的命令类型显示不同的结果集,如查询结果、受影响的行数等。

5. 处理错误和警告

如果在执行 SQL 文件过程中遇到错误或警告,DBeaver 会在“输出”面板中显示相应的错误信息。请仔细阅读错误信息,并根据提示进行相应的处理。

6. 保存执行结果

如果您需要保存执行结果,可以在“结果”面板中选择要保存的结果集,然后右键点击选择“保存结果”选项。在弹出的保存对话框中,选择保存的文件格式和保存位置,然后点击“保存”按钮。

7. 注意事项

  • 在执行 SQL 文件之前,请确保您已经备份了数据库,以防意外情况发生。
  • 在执行可能影响数据库结构的 SQL 命令(如 CREATE TABLE、ALTER TABLE 等)之前,请务必谨慎检查命令的正确性。
  • 如果 SQL 文件包含多个命令,您可以通过选中或取消选中命令前的复选框来选择性地执行其中的命令。

通过本文的介绍,您应该已经掌握了在 DBeaver 中执行 SQL 文件的方法。在实际应用中,您可以根据具体需求灵活运用 DBeaver 的各项功能,以提高数据库操作的效率和准确性。如果您还有其他关于 DBeaver 的问题或需求,欢迎随时提问。